Examine Door Seals





3 straightforward steps can help you assure your home appliance's door seals are in excellent condition. Initially, inspect the seals routinely for any kind of cracks, splits, or indicators of wear. These damages can bring about air leaks, impacting performance. 2nd, tidy the seals using cozy, soapy water to get rid of any debris or gunk. A tidy seal assures a tight fit and better performance. Perform an easy examination by shutting the door on an item of paper. If you can easily pull it out without resistance, the seal may need changing. By adhering to these actions, you'll keep your appliance's efficiency and durability, saving you money on energy expenses and repair services in the future.


Monitor Temperature Settings



Regularly checking your appliance's temperature settings is essential for ideal efficiency and effectiveness. Whether you're taking care of a refrigerator, freezer, or stove, maintaining an eye on these setups can avoid many issues. For fridges, goal for temperatures between 35 ° F and 38 ° F; for fridges freezer, stay 0 ° F. If the temperatures are too high or low, your device may work harder, throwing away power and shortening its lifespan. Make use of a thermostat to inspect these settings consistently, specifically after major adjustments, like relocating your home appliance or adjusting the thermostat. If you observe fluctuations, adjust the settings accordingly and speak with the user manual for advice. By staying aggressive regarding temperature tracking, you'll guarantee your home appliances run smoothly and last much longer.


Fixing Air Conditioning Issues



When your refrigerator isn't cooling down effectively, it can result in ruined food and threw away money, so attending to the concern quickly is vital. Beginning by checking the temperature settings to confirm they go to the advised levels, typically around 37 ° F for the fridge and 0 ° F for the fridge freezer. If the settings are proper, evaluate the door seals for any kind of spaces or damages; a damaged seal can allow warm air to enter.


Inspect the condenser coils, typically located at the back or base of the device. Tidy them with a vacuum or brush to enhance performance. If problems persist, it could be time to call a specialist.

Protect Against Ice Formation



To stop ice formation in your home appliances, begin by validating the temperature level setups are appropriate. If your fridge or freezer is too cold, it can result in extreme ice build-up. Examine the door seals frequently; harmed seals can allow warm air in, triggering condensation and ice formation.

Just how Commonly Should I Clean the Fridge Coils?



You should cleanse your refrigerator coils every six months. This aids preserve effectiveness and stops getting too hot. If you notice excessive dust or family pet hair, tidy them a lot more regularly to guarantee your fridge runs efficiently.

Does a Refrigerator Need to Be Leveled?



Yes, your refrigerator requires to be leveled. If it's irregular, it can influence cooling down efficiency and cause excess noise. Examine the progressing legs and change them to ensure proper balance for perfect efficiency.


How Can I Reduce Refrigerator Power Intake?



To lower your fridge's energy consumption, maintain it tidy and well-ventilated, examine door seals for leakages, established the temperature level between 35-38 ° F, and stay clear of overloading it. These actions can substantially reduce your energy expenses.
